Jimmy Kimmel is set to return to ABC with Jimmy Kimmel Live! after a brief suspension over his comments regarding Charlie Kirk’s assassination. Despite his anger at being pulled off the air, insiders reveal that he is coming back primarily out of respect for his team, ensuring that crew members don’t miss pay or face additional work disruption.
The controversy began when Kimmel criticized the “MAGA gang” for politicizing Kirk’s death and mocked the national response of lowering flags to half-mast, which led to his suspension. While it’s unclear whether he will apologize or continue to critique the situation, insiders expect him to address the issue boldly on his return, saying:
“The last week has made his balls bigger, not smaller. I expect him to come out swinging… We are depending on him to stand up for what’s right.”
Sources also indicate that Kimmel plans to leave ABC when his contract expires in May 2026, unless a substantial offer is made. His temporary return allows the staff time to plan their next steps, reflecting his concern for his team over his personal grievances. Essentially, Jimmy is back on air for his crew, not because the suspension changed his mind about ABC.
